How we compared the best custom socks companies

We judged each supplier on the things that actually decide whether branded socks land or flop: construction (knitted versus printed), material quality, minimum order, lead time, price, packaging, and how well they handle a real company programme rather than a one-off order. The single biggest divider is construction, so it is worth saying plainly up front.

  • Knitted socks build the design from coloured yarn as the sock is made. They look crisp on the foot and hold up wash after wash.
  • Printed (sublimated) socks spray the design onto a finished sock. It is faster and cheaper, but the print shows white lines when the sock stretches over a foot.
  • ~100 pairs: typical minimum order for knitted socks (industry norm; printed runs can go lower)
  • 2 to 3 weeks: standard production lead time (longer for 10,000+ pairs)
  • €4 to €6 per pair at volume, knitted: varies by yarn, size and run

What is the minimum order for custom socks?

For knitted socks, expect a minimum of around 100 pairs, because the knitting machine has to be set up and test runs produced. Some printed suppliers offer lower or no minimums, but printed socks wear differently from knitted ones.

How much do custom socks cost?

Roughly four to six euros per pair at volume for knitted socks, or about 800 euros total at the 100-pair minimum. Premium US suppliers can run higher, around $10 to $18 a pair. Lead time is typically two to three weeks.

Are knitted or printed custom socks better?

Knitted, for anything worn repeatedly. Knitted socks build the design from yarn so it stays crisp under stretch and lasts. Printed (sublimated) socks handle complex full-colour artwork and lower volumes, but the design can show white lines when the sock is on a foot.
